Make sure they all get their vaccinatiosn for Kitty Distemper/Feline luekemia...

Kittens are much more susceptible to upper respiratory infection when they arent vaccinated within a month or so after birth ...you better do it now before she can collapse and die on you.....as well as the other littermates...

Shes gorgeous, but she does have a swollen eye and that usually means she has an upper respiratory infection w/ eye discharge[green ucky oozing stuff ]...

keep us posted after her vet exam.
